How much can you earn on Airbnb in Bad Wiessee, Bavaria? Based on AirROI's 2026 dataset (April 2025 – March 2026), the short answer is $19,300 per year — at a $197 nightly rate, 32.8% occupancy, and a $67 RevPAR that reflects a wider gap between nightly rates and realized revenue that rewards occupancy-focused strategies.
At 79 active listings, Bad Wiessee is a boutique market where selective demand that rewards strong listing quality and pricing strategy. Supply grew 16.2% over the past year, yet revenue and nightly rates both trended upward — a signal that traveler demand is outpacing new inventory rather than being diluted by it. For hosts, pricing power remains intact even as competition increases.
Regulation is low with minimal registration requirements, pointing to an operator-friendly environment. In a market this size, differentiated listings with strong reviews can capture outsized returns relative to the competition.

When Is the Peak Season for Airbnb in Bad Wiessee?
Bad Wiessee's peak Airbnb season falls in July, August, September, while the softest stretch is January, February, March. Overall, the market shows highly seasonal trends requiring careful strategy, which should guide pricing, minimum stays, and cash-flow planning.
Peak Season (July, August, September)
- Revenue averages $3,544 per month
- Occupancy rates average 50.2%
- Daily rates average $225
Shoulder Season
- Revenue averages $1,896 per month
- Occupancy maintains around 31.8%
- Daily rates hold near $196
Low Season (January, February, March)
- Revenue drops to average $1,093 per month
- Occupancy decreases to average 20.5%
- Daily rates adjust to average $179

Bad Wiessee Airbnb Cancellation Policy Trends Analysis (2026)
Super Strict 60 Days
1 listings
1.3% of total
Super Strict 30 Days
3 listings
3.8% of total
Flexible
6 listings
7.6% of total
Moderate
32 listings
40.5% of total
Firm
31 listings
39.2% of total
Strict
6 listings
7.6% of total
Cancellation Policy Insights for Bad Wiessee
- The prevailing Airbnb cancellation policy trend in Bad Wiessee is Moderate, used by 40.5% of listings.
- There's a relatively balanced mix between guest-friendly (48.1%) and stricter (46.8%) policies, offering choices for different guest needs.
- Strict cancellation policies are quite rare (7.6%), potentially making listings with this policy less competitive unless justified by high demand or property type.
